-====== 1G Memory Module Reset ====== 
- 
-It's very rare, but every once in a while a user will report that their 1G car either reports crazy values for various settings in DSMLink or might not even start the car at all.  It's happened, probably, 4 or 5 times in about 2 years or so that we're aware of.  When this happens, you may need to do a hard reset of the 1G memory module.  ​ 
- 
-====== Details ====== 
- 
-The following describes how to perform a hard reset of the 1G memory module. 
- 
-  - Turn the key on (don't start the engine) 
-  - Wait for the CEL light to go back off after 5 seconds just as a check that the ECU is up and running normally. 
-  - Press the throttle to the floor and keep it there as you cycle the ignition key off and then back on 3 or 4 times. I usually go for 4 but 3 is the minimum. 
- 
-Once you have done that, the ECU should reset back to the hardcoded defaults in the chip.
